BRITISH SHIP FIRED ON.

BY INSURGENT TRAWLERS. (Received 12.40 p.m.) Uuiteci Press Assn.—By Electric Telegi a ph—Co py right. LONDON. August 29. The Admiralty states that two* insurgent trawlers fired warning shots at the Bramhill from* Brest in the neighbourhood of Gijon. 'Flip Bramhill did not consider that she was within territorial waters and continued her voyage after which two more warning shots were fired.

The JL M. S. F earless arrived and the incident closed alter an exchange of signals.
